Elizabeth A. “Betty” Widmar, age 79 of Kenosha, died at her home, on Sunday, November 27, 2016, after a long battle with health problems.
Born in Kenosha, on March 9, 1937, she was the daughter of the late Frank A. and Josephine (Klobuchar) Widmar. She was educated in Kenosha schools and attended Gateway Technical College.
Betty was employed as an assistant to Dr. Fiorini, Dr. Ferrell; Attorneys Zagoras & Hanrath and Dr. Luben Atzeff, until her retirement in 1998. After she retired, Betty worked a few hours a week at her son’s business, Millhouse Auto Body in Kenosha.
In 1955, she married William R. Millhouse. They divorced after 23 year together.
She loved to play golf, dance and read. She also enjoyed her trips to Las Vegas and was an avid Packer fan. She loved to redecorate and did so often.
Betty has many special cousins, especially Tony, Bill and Jerry Widmar along with their wives and enjoyed getting together with them. Sylvia Shierk, Marlene Schmaling, Cookie Liegakos were devoted friends. Getting together with family was very special to her.
She is survived by her wonderful children, Billy and Bobby (Susan) Mill house and Sandra (Jim) Grumbeck; her much loved grandchildren, Jake Grumbeck, Jade (Kevin) Bell, Jasmin Grumbeck and Luke and Zachary Millhouse along with her great-granddaughter, Mia Bell. She is further survived by her brothers, Robert and Jack and a sister Connie (Rich) Richards.
Along with her parents, she was preceded in death by a daughter, Sheree Lynn Resop; her brothers, Richard, Frank and Edward Widmar; her ex-husband, Bill Millhouse and her beloved companion Yorkie, Lexi.
